Do Kwon obtained a 15-year jail sentence in the USA over the collapse of TerraUSD and Luna, however his authorized state of affairs stays unresolved and factors to a second prison course of in South Korea.
The ruling was handed down by federal choose Paul Engelmayer in Manhattan, after a case that proved a fraud scheme between 2018 and 2022. The investigation discovered that Terraform Labs hid exterior interventions to artificially assist TerraUSD’s peg, whereas Do Kwon publicly claimed the system operated autonomously. The ultimate collapse in Might 2022 erased almost $40 billion and triggered a series response that reached different corporations throughout the crypto market.
Nonetheless, South Korean prosecutors are sustaining separate costs for violations of the Capital Markets Act and are signaling a possible sentence exceeding 30 years. The core argument is {that a} home trial permits authorities to handle the injury suffered by about 200,000 victims within the nation, with estimated losses of 300 billion gained, equal to $204 million. Ten of Kwon’s associates have already been standing trial in Seoul for almost three years.

Kwon Might Request a Switch to Korea After Serving Half His Sentence
This situation rests on the truth that, after serving half of his US sentence, Kwon can apply to the Worldwide Prisoner Switch Program. As a part of his plea settlement, US prosecutors wouldn’t block such a request. If the switch goes by way of, Korea can prosecute him with out taking into consideration the sentence imposed in New York. Engelmayer explicitly rejected lowering the sentence on that foundation and acknowledged that a court docket can not sentence primarily based on potential selections by one other jurisdiction.
The case additionally revealed that, when TerraUSD misplaced its peg in Might 2021, Terraform Labs relied on covert purchases by way of a agency linked to Soar Buying and selling. That intervention briefly supported the value and was by no means disclosed to traders. A 12 months later, the system collapsed with out backing and dragged down funds, platforms, and tasks linked to the Terra ecosystem.


The Minimal Viable Sentence
Kwon pleaded responsible to 9 counts, together with fraud and cash laundering. The choose additionally ordered the forfeiture of $19 million in illicit good points. Federal tips pointed to a theoretical sentence of as much as 130 years, however the plea deal capped the prosecution’s suggestion at 12. The court docket imposed 15 and outlined it as the minimal viable sentence within the face of a fraud it described as one of the damaging in current historical past
